Abstract

In this paper, a two-step trajectory planning algorithm from robotics literature is applied to generate suitable trajectories for an autonomous parking maneuver of a car. First, a collision-free curve between a given start and a desired goal configuration within the parking space is planned ignoring the kinematic restrictions on the movement of the car. Second, the collision-free curve is converted into a feasible collision-free trajectory, which can be exactly followed by the car. It is shown how this general planning scheme must be adapted to meet the requirements of the automotive industry
